A Research Associate in the biotechnology industry plays a crucial role in investigating, analyzing, and interpreting data associated with biological, chemical, and physical experiments. They typically work in a team to design and implement experiments, help develop new products or procedures, and quality control. Their tasks may include carrying out laboratory procedures, documenting results, and presenting research findings. Additionally, they may also be tasked to supervise junior staff and ensure compliance with safety standards and protocols.

To excel in this role, a Research Associate should possess a strong understanding of laboratory procedures, exc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, and proficiency in using diverse scientific software and equipment. They should hold a degree in Biotechnology or a related field, while a Master's degree or Ph.D. may be preferred for some positions. Certifications such as Certified Laboratory Technician (CLT) or Certified Biomedical Auditor (CBA) can also be beneficial. Prior to becoming a Research Associate, an individual could have roles such as Laboratory Technician, Research Assistant, or even Quality Control Analyst.
